Output 86d6ec3d39a956b15eeba2c5e4b1a91c67c6fb56df253b47169fb142ebf185f8:0

value
42995008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ad48b62abe5a4c5734b5b454441695967da897d OP_EQUAL
address
3CtUyo88qKDkcTgSUPK5byNTxb4XHr5zjZ
transaction
86d6ec3d39a956b15eeba2c5e4b1a91c67c6fb56df253b47169fb142ebf185f8
spent
true